置换流水车间调度问题的MATLAB求解.pdf
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
【置换流水车间调度问题的MATLAB求解】是物流运筹实务课程设计中的一个重要主题,主要探讨如何使用MATLAB解决这种经典优化问题。置换流水车间调度问题(PFSP)是流水车间调度问题的一个子问题,它针对单件小批量生产环境,其中每个工件有相同的工序顺序,目标是最小化最大完工时间,以提高生产效率和资源利用率。 PFSP的模型通常是n个工件在m台机器上完成m道工序,每道工序在不同机器上执行,且所有工件的工序顺序固定。目标是找到最佳的工件加工顺序和开始时间,使得最大完工时间达到最小。由于问题的复杂性,它被归类为NP难问题,意味着没有已知的多项式时间解决方案。 MATLAB作为一个强大的数值计算工具,因其高度集成的特性,包括科学计算、图像处理和自动化功能,成为解决这类问题的理想选择。通过结合典型的JSP模型和MATLAB的应用,可以有效地求解调度问题,尽管对于大型问题,最优解可能难以获得,但可以通过启发式算法找到近似最优解。 实验中,使用了Carlier (1978)的8个算例和Reeves (1995)的21个算例进行最小化最大完工时间问题的求解,以三元组表示法(F prmu Cmax)进行表述。例如,一个产品有4道工序,需要加工13个工件,每个工件的流程相同,加工时间表给出,然后通过计算确定最大完工时间并寻找优化策略。 计算过程通常包括确定初始完工时间,如c( j1,1)等于第一台机器的第一个工件的加工时间,后续工序的时间基于前一工序加上相应的加工时间。这样的步骤持续进行,直至所有工件在所有机器上的工序完成,最终优化整个调度以最小化最大完工时间。 这个课题的研究对企业生产管理和资源优化有着深远的影响,它不仅在理论上提供了组合优化问题的解决思路,也在实践中帮助提升制造业的效率和经济效益。MATLAB的运用使得原本复杂的数学模型能够更高效地求解,为实际生产调度提供了实用的工具。
剩余18页未读,继续阅读
- 粉丝: 1w+
- 资源: 5万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助